From Technician to Leader: ITSM Career Growth Strategies
Transitioning from a technician role within the realm of IT Service Management (ITSM) leadership can be a challenging journey. Leveraging your technical foundation while honing essential leadership skills is key to navigating this journey.
First of all, prioritize structured training programs and certifications that support your ITSM knowledge base. Comprehend industry best practices like ITIL, COBIT, and ISO/IEC 20000. Connecting with veteran ITSM professionals can provide invaluable counsel.
Proactively participate in industry events, join professional organizations, and connect with peers to enlarge your network.
- Present strong communication, problem-solving, and decision-making skills.
- Seek out opportunities to lead projects and teams, showcasing your guidance abilities.
- Keep abreast on emerging ITSM trends and technologies through continuous learning.
Remember, tenacity and a willingness to learn are crucial for fulfilling your ITSM leadership goals. By strategically enhancing your skills and expanding your network, you can effectively transition from a technician to a respected leader in the ITSM field.

Launch into Building Your Success Story: A Roadmap for IT Service Management Careers
A career in IT Service Management grants a wealth of options for individuals passionate about technology and patron satisfaction. Crafting a successful journey within this dynamic field necessitates a well-defined roadmap, one that navigates you through the intricacies of service delivery and cultivates essential skills.
Start by recognizing your abilities and connecting them with particular roles within IT Service Management. Prominent paths comprise service desk analyst, support engineer, incident manager, and change manager, each adding a unique aspect to the overall service lifecycle.
- Seek industry-recognized approvals.
- Improve your expert skills in areas such as help desk software, ticketing systems, and IT infrastructure management.
- Connect with other professionals in the field through conferences to build your knowledge and build valuable connections.
Relentless learning is important in IT Service Management. Stay knowledgeable with the latest trends, technologies, and best practices through workshops.
